After rubbing the hair on your head with a balloon, you determine there are 2.4 x 1018 electrons on your head. What is the charge, in coulombs (C), of your head?

Answer:

q = 0.384 C

Explanation:

The total charge present at the head can be easily found out by multiplying the charge on a single electron with the total number of electrons present on the head:

[tex]q = ne[/tex]

where,

q = total charge on head = ?

n = total no. of electrons on the head = 2.4 x 10¹⁸

e = charge on 1 electron = 1.6 x 10⁻¹⁹ C

Therefore,

[tex]q = (2.4\ x\ 10^{18})(1.6\ x\ 10^{-19}\ C)[/tex]

q = 0.384 C
